MSDeploy Пакетная фильтрация файлов - PullRequest
3 голосов
/ 15 марта 2012

В моем скрипте MSBuild я использую MSDeploy для упаковки и развертывания моего веб-сайта ASP.NET MVC.

<Exec Command='  "@(MsDeploy)" -verb:sync -source:iisApp="$(Source)" -dest:package="$(Destination)" '/>

Проблема заключается в том, что мои * .less файлы не добавляются в пакет развертывания.

Есть ли параметры или конфигурация, которую я могу настроить, чтобы эти файлы добавлялись в пакет развертывания.

1 Ответ

4 голосов
/ 16 марта 2012

По умолчанию конвейер веб-публикации будет подбирать только файлы, необходимые для развертывания (если вы не укажете по-другому на вкладке «Пакет / публикация в Интернете»), что означает, что для действия компоновки должно быть содержимое этих файлов. (Свойство «Построить действие» можно увидеть в окне «Свойства» в Visual Studio при выборе файла в обозревателе решений.) См. Часто задаваемые вопросы по развертыванию в MSDN:

http://msdn.microsoft.com/en-us/library/ee942158.aspx#why_dont_all_files_get_deployed

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...